Decorating With Sage Green Is a Thing for 2018, According to Pinterest

Freshome Design & Architecture Magazine

Pinterest put out their top 100 list of pins list and it looks like decorating with sage green is a favorite among pinners. Sage green is neutral, calming and can flow nicely with nearly any design style including the most popular at the moment: Farmhouse and Mid Century Modern. Sage varies in lightness and saturation.

Full-On Color

Tile of Spain USA

Color is one of the main elements in interior design because of its powerful effect on the atmosphere and style of a space. For years, the number one trend in decor has been neutral shades and minimalism, however we are now seeing a welcome return of bold color.
